Vital Steps in Registering an RTO

Early Research and Planning: In preparation for begin the RTO application method, conduct exhaustive research to comprehend the market demand for the subjects you want to offer. Ensure you fulfil the essential criteria, such as having suitable facilities and trained staff.

Application Document Compilation: Develop extensive documentation exhibiting your adherence with the VET Quality Framework and the National Standards for RTOs 2024. Essential documents for instance your business plan, assessment strategies (TAS), and policies and procedures.

Filing Application: Submit your application documents via ASQA's online portal, including all necessary documents and the application charge.

Examination by ASQA: ASQA will assess your enrolment and may conduct a site inspection to validate adherence to the criteria. In the process of this audit, ASQA will assess your facilities, materials, and documents.

Results and Registration: If your sign-up fulfils all requirements, ASQA will register your group as an RTO, giving you with a Registration Certificate and registering your information on the national listing.

Financial Stability: You need to illustrate that your group is financially viable, offering financial forecasts, funding evidence, and a well-outlined business plan.

Fit and Proper Person Requirements: ASQA demands that important personnel in your company fulfil the fit and proper person criteria, for example having a proper conduct and no history of notable offenses.

Training Assets and Assessment Resources: Make sure you have appropriate resources to conduct and review the courses you provide, for example trained instructors and assessors, adequate premises, and adequate learning materials.

Adherence to VET Quality Framework and National Standards for RTOs 2024: Your company must adhere to the VET Quality Framework, comprising the Standards for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) 2015, the Fit and Proper Person Conditions, the Financial Viability Risk Assessment Criteria, the Data Provision Requirements, and the Australian Qualifications Standards. Investment for RTO Registration

The monetary costs of RTO registration can range based on several aspects, for example the scope of your group, the offerings you plan to offer, and the resources you need. Here are some typical outlays you may bear:

- Application Fee: ASQA demands an application fee for RTO registration, which can range subject to the extent and dimension of your application documents.
- Assessment Costs: If ASQA carries out a location audit, you may need to incur the charges associated with the evaluation, including travel outlays for ASQA auditors.
- Assets Costs: Funding for training and assessment resources, like competent trainers and assessors, adequate premises, and ample learning materials.
- Advisory Fees: Employing a expert for aid with the application procedure will entail additional outlays.
